Travel Documents & Requirements

Invoices, final documents, passports, visas, and entry requirements.

Check your email first. Search for Pavlus, your travel partner’s name, your booking number, or your destination — and check your spam, junk, and deleted folders.

If you still cannot find it, submit a request for a duplicate and include your booking number and traveler name.

Final travel documents are released by the travel provider closer to departure, not immediately after final payment. Timing varies by cruise line and tour company.

Most cruise lines release final documents electronically about 20–30 days before departure. Once they reach Pavlus, Guest Relations reviews them and forwards them to you.

If you are still more than 30 days from departure, your final documents may simply not be available yet.

Passport and traveler information requirements vary by travel provider. Many cruise lines and tour companies let guests enter passport details directly through their own online guest portal.

When entering passport information:

  • Enter your name exactly as it appears on your passport
  • Double-check the passport number
  • Verify the issue and expiration dates
  • Verify nationality and date of birth

If your passport is renewed after you first entered the information, update the travel provider’s record as soon as possible.

Entry requirements depend on your:

  • Citizenship
  • Passport
  • Destination
  • Countries visited during the itinerary
  • Transit points
  • Length and purpose of travel

These requirements change and are set by government authorities, not by Pavlus Travel. Travelers are responsible for having the proper passport, visa, ETA, and entry documentation for their itinerary.

Do not rely on the requirements that applied to a previous trip.

Transfers & Transportation

Airport and pier transfers — what is included, how to arrange one, and where to find your instructions.

Not always. Transfers may be:

  • Included with your package
  • Included only when using the travel provider’s airfare
  • Included only on specific arrival or departure dates
  • Available for purchase
  • Arranged independently

Review the transfer section of your invoice and travel documents first. If a transfer does not appear on your confirmation, do not assume one has been arranged.

Before requesting a transfer, gather:

  • Arrival and departure airport
  • Airline and flight number
  • Arrival and departure date
  • Arrival and departure time
  • Hotel name, if applicable
  • Ship and cruise port
  • Number of travelers

Transfer options cannot be determined accurately without complete flight and itinerary information.

Transfer pricing varies based on destination, number of travelers, distance, vehicle type, arrival time, travel partner, and whether the service is private or shared.

For an accurate quote, send your complete transportation details rather than asking for a general transfer price.

Your final transfer documentation gives the instructions specific to your reservation. Depending on the service, you may:

  • Meet a representative in baggage claim
  • Look for a sign with your name
  • Report to a designated cruise-line meeting point
  • Call or message the driver after you arrive
  • Meet in a hotel lobby or another designated location

Always follow the instructions in your final documents rather than general information found online.

Check, in this order:

  1. Your Pavlus invoice
  2. Your transfer confirmation or voucher
  3. Your final travel documents
  4. The travel provider’s guest portal, when applicable

Your final documents are the best source for meeting instructions and local contact information.

Transportation that is not part of your booked package is considered independent travel. Depending on the destination, options may include hotel transportation, taxi, rideshare, train, public transportation, or a private transfer.

For independently arranged transportation, confirm current local options and travel times shortly before departure, since availability and pricing change.

Shore Excursions & Tours

Booking windows for excursions and reading what your land tour includes.

Shore excursion reservations are generally made through the cruise line or travel provider’s online guest portal.

Booking windows vary by provider and may depend on your sailing date, stateroom category, loyalty status, or final payment status. If excursions are not yet available, check the opening date shown by your travel provider.

Popular excursions sell out, so we recommend reviewing options as soon as your booking window opens.

Your detailed itinerary is the best source for what is included each day. Look for included sightseeing, optional excursions, meals, hotels, transportation, free time, and arrival and departure services.

Pay close attention to wording such as included, optional, at leisure, and at additional cost.

If you are planning independent activities during free time, check the tour schedule first to avoid conflicts.

Cabins & Upgrades

Category availability, how upgrades and upgrade bids differ, and bed configurations.

Availability changes continuously. A category that was available when you booked — or even earlier the same day — may no longer be available.

Current availability and pricing have to be checked at the moment you are considering a change.

There are several kinds of upgrade, and they are not interchangeable:

  • Complimentary promotional upgrades
  • Paid category changes
  • Cruise-line upgrade offers
  • Upgrade bidding programs

A paid upgrade changes your confirmed reservation and is subject to current pricing and availability. An upgrade bid is an offer submitted directly to the cruise line and is not guaranteed to be accepted — bids may be accepted as late as three days before embarkation, so plan around your existing stateroom until an upgrade is officially confirmed.

Usually a change can be requested if another eligible cabin is available. However, changing cabins may affect your fare, promotions, amenities, onboard credit, deposit terms, or accessibility features.

If you want to change cabins within the same category, our Guest Relations team is happy to review the available options with you.

If you are interested in changing your stateroom category or room type, reach out to your Pavlus Travel Planner, who can review current availability, pricing, and any applicable promotions.

Many cruise staterooms can be configured as either one larger bed or two separate beds, but this varies by ship and by cabin.

Bed preferences can usually be requested in advance, but they remain subject to the configuration available onboard.

Dining & Onboard Credit

How dining reservations work and how to check and use your onboard credit.

Dining policies vary significantly by cruise line. Depending on your sailing, dining may be open seating, assigned seating, reservation-based, bookable before sailing, or reserved onboard.

Specialty dining may have its own booking windows based on stateroom category or loyalty level.

Use your cruise line’s guest portal for the dining rules and reservation options specific to your sailing.

Check your Pavlus invoice for onboard credits associated with your booking. Credits can come from several sources:

  • Pavlus Travel
  • Promotions
  • Loyalty programs
  • Shareholder benefits
  • Specific amenities

Some credits are per person and some are per stateroom.

This depends on the type of credit and on the cruise line. Eligible purchases may include shore excursions, specialty dining, spa services, beverages, shopping, gratuities, and other onboard purchases.

Some credits are restricted to a specific purpose and some are non-refundable. Check the terms attached to your particular credit before you sail.

Changes, Cancellations & Refunds

How to cancel properly, how penalties are determined, and refund timing.

Cancellation requests should be submitted directly to your Pavlus Personal Travel Planner. Include:

  • Booking number
  • The specific traveler(s) being canceled, if applicable
  • A clear request to cancel

Do not simply stop making payments. Failing to pay and formally canceling a reservation are not necessarily treated the same way, and cancellation penalties can be significant. The applicable terms are listed on your cruise or tour invoice.

Cancellation penalties are determined by the terms of your specific reservation and may vary based on the travel partner, fare type, date booked, departure date, current cancellation date, promotional terms, and any non-refundable components.

Do not rely on a general cancellation chart found online unless it applies specifically to your booking. Review the terms included with your confirmation before canceling.

Refund timing depends on the company processing the refund and on your original payment method.

A refund approval and the date funds appear on your credit card are not the same date. Once a provider issues a refund, your bank or card issuer may need additional processing time before the credit appears — a general guideline is 7–10 business days.
